Body

Origins and Family

Robert Picou was born in Tours[2]. He was born on January 1, 1593[3].

Career and Affiliations

Recorded occupations include painter[6], draftsperson[7], etcher[8], engraver[9], valet de chambre[10], and graphic artist[12]. Among Robert Picou's employers was Louis XIII of France[13].

Death and Burial

Robert Picou died on April 16, 1671[5]. He passed away in Paris[4].
